  4. On a trials bike you get a lot of tension in and around the welds because they are in the edges of the geometry where the majority of the forces occurs. And they don't x-ray the welds for micro cracks that may have been a part of this. It could be fault in the material or the welding like to fast cooling.

    Why the crack came in that specific area it's because the rhombic shape wants to go square when you put a down force on the pedals and a counterforce on the wheel and head tube.

    Making an good video.... It's not all about the riding it self. You can be an awful rider but make an interesting video that gets people to watch till the end and actually like it.

    The best way to learn how to make a good video is watching other popular videos professionals and amateurs. Take notes of how they are made, clips, effects, repeating clips, angles etc. Choice of music, make the pictures float with the music and so on. Try to look for those things that make it look good beside the actual riding.

    And then practice, make videos ask for critics. Listen to the critics and see if you can change it.
